Skip to main content

¿Cuál es el mejor software o hardware basado en RAID?

Como clonar windows 10 sin PC - Tacens portum duo II (Abril 2025)

Como clonar windows 10 sin PC - Tacens portum duo II (Abril 2025)
Anonim

Un gabinete RAID externo es una forma popular de aumentar el almacenamiento disponible de sus computadoras al mismo tiempo que agrega un aumento en el rendimiento o la protección de datos o ambos. Una de las preguntas clave a responder cuando se busca un sistema de almacenamiento RAID externo es cómo se realizarán las funciones RAID, en software o mediante hardware dedicado.

¿Por qué un recinto RAID externo?

Seamos claros, si su propósito principal es solamente expandir la cantidad de espacio disponible en la unidad, puede encontrar que una sola unidad externa puede ser una opción mucho menos costosa. El único disco externo es muy versátil; Se puede usar para espacio de almacenamiento adicional, como unidad de respaldo o para instalar sistemas operativos alternativos.

Por otro lado, un gabinete basado en RAID se diseñará para albergar múltiples unidades y ofrecer al usuario la capacidad de configurar el gabinete en una o más configuraciones RAID.

Los gabinetes RAID pueden configurarse para proporcionar niveles de rendimiento más altos que los que normalmente se encuentran disponibles en unidades individuales, también pueden proporcionar redundancia de datos, asegurando que sus datos estén disponibles incluso si falla una unidad. Los sistemas RAID también se pueden configurar tanto para el rendimiento como para la protección de datos.

Controlador RAID basado en software o hardware

El corazón de un sistema RAID es el controlador, que controla la distribución de datos hacia y desde las unidades que conforman la matriz RAID. Los controladores RAID pueden estar basados ​​en hardware, usando un chip integrado en el gabinete RAID, o basados ​​en software, usando la potencia de cómputo de su computadora para controlar cómo se leen o escriben los datos en el gabinete.

La sabiduría común ha sido que los controladores basados ​​en hardware tienen la ventaja en el rendimiento, ya que pueden realizar los cálculos necesarios para dirigir los datos hacia y desde las unidades en una matriz RAID sin introducir un cuello de botella en el rendimiento. Los sistemas basados ​​en software solían ser menos costosos y podían funcionar adecuadamente para tres niveles RAID populares, RAID 0 (Striped for speed), RAID 1 (Datos duplicados para redundancia) y RAID 10 (Conjunto duplicado de unidades Striped). Pero tenía problemas de rendimiento con niveles RAID más complejos.

Los niveles RAID avanzados, como RAID 3 y RAID 5, que protegían los datos mediante el uso de cálculos complejos para generar datos de paridad que se escribieron junto con el flujo de datos existente, se consideraron al mismo tiempo una tensión excesiva en los sistemas basados ​​en software y dieron como resultado niveles de rendimiento superiores a los que se vieron con los controladores RAID basados ​​en hardware.

Sin embargo, los diseños de procesadores modernos que utilizan múltiples núcleos de procesamiento, junto con los sistemas operativos modernos que aprovechan los procesadores de múltiples núcleos, han eliminado prácticamente la penalización de rendimiento en los sistemas RAID basados ​​en software, al menos para los niveles RAID básicos de 0, 1, 3 , 5 y 10.

RAID basado en software

Los sistemas RAID que hacen uso del control basado en software tienen las siguientes características:

  • Costo reducido: dado que el gabinete RAID puede hacer uso de conjuntos de chips de interfaz estándar, los costos de diseño y fabricación se mantienen bajos para el gabinete RAID. El costo del software puede ser tan bajo como cero, ya que muchos sistemas operativos incluyen soporte incorporado para los niveles RAID más básicos, por lo general 0, 1, 10. Si necesita RAID 3 o 5, existen aplicaciones de software de costo adicional disponibles que pueden tomar cuidado de sus necesidades.
  • Versatilidad: los controladores RAID basados ​​en software permiten la mayor flexibilidad para configurar cómo se utilizará cada unidad dentro de un gabinete. En un recinto de cuatro unidades; podría tener tres unidades configuradas como una matriz rayada para el rendimiento y 1 unidad grande para copia de seguridad. También puede configurar las cuatro unidades como dos matrices independientes, un conjunto de bandas para la edición de video y un conjunto duplicado para varias bibliotecas multimedia. El punto es que la forma en que se utilizan las unidades en el gabinete depende completamente de usted.
  • Rendimiento: Es probable que los sistemas RAID basados ​​en software utilizados para matrices con bandas básicas o matrices duplicadas no vean una penalización de rendimiento. Sin embargo, a medida que crece la cantidad de unidades utilizadas en una matriz, o se usan niveles RAID más complejos, las aplicaciones RAID basadas en software pueden comenzar a afectar el rendimiento del sistema RAID, así como el rendimiento general de la computadora.
  • Gastos generales: RAID basado en software hace uso de uno o más núcleos de CPU, así como RAM que podría afectar otros procesos que se ejecutan en su computadora. El alcance del impacto se basa en el nivel de RAID que se está utilizando y en la cantidad de unidades que conforman la matriz RAID.
  • Arranque: este es un caso mixto, algún software RAID funciona bien con el arranque desde una matriz RAID, y otros tienen problemas. Si sus planes incluían el arranque desde su matriz RAID, asegúrese de verificar que el software RAID que planea usar sea compatible con el arranque.

RAID basado en hardware

Los gabinetes RAID que usan un controlador RAID basado en hardware tienen las siguientes características:

  • Costo: los gabinetes RAID basados ​​en hardware tendrán una prima en precio en comparación con los gabinetes de compartimientos múltiples sin soporte RAID incorporado. Sin embargo, la diferencia de precio puede ser pequeña. El hardware RAID básico que solo admite unidades de banda, duplicadas o independientes tiene una prima de costo muy pequeña, mientras que los controladores RAID basados ​​en hardware que admiten niveles RAID adicionales y más unidades dentro de la matriz pueden tener una prima de precio mucho mayor.
  • Autónomo: los sistemas RAID basados ​​en hardware aparecen en el sistema operativo del host como un solo disco. Esto permite que el sistema RAID sea transparente para la computadora a la que está conectado. El resultado es que los sistemas RAID basados ​​en hardware se transportan fácilmente entre computadoras y sistemas operativos.
  • Rendimiento: si bien el software y el RAID basado en hardware pueden tener números de rendimiento similares para los niveles básicos rayados y duplicados, una vez que pasa a niveles RAID más elaborados, los sistemas basados ​​en hardware tienden a superar a sus equivalentes basados ​​en software. Este rendimiento mejorado no se limita a solo escribir y leer datos, sino que también se muestra cuando los datos RAID duplicados deben reconstruirse debido a una falla en la unidad. Los sistemas RAID basados ​​en hardware suelen realizar el proceso de reconstrucción mucho más rápido que los sistemas basados ​​en software.
  • Sobrecarga: los gabinetes RAID externos basados ​​en hardware no deberían producir ningún impacto en la sobrecarga del procesador o RAM en la computadora host.
  • Arranque: en general, los sistemas RAID basados ​​en hardware pueden usarse como su sistema de arranque siempre que la conexión a su computadora use un tipo de puerto desde el cual el sistema operativo admite el arranque. Los puertos USB 3 y Thunderbolt generalmente deben poder iniciarse, pero verifique con el sistema operativo y el fabricante de la computadora para asegurarse.

Recomendaciones RAID

  • El RAID basado en software se pone en marcha cuando la fuerza impulsora es mantener el costo bajo y su uso de RAID se limitará a RAID 0 (rayas), Raid 1 (duplicado) o RAID 10 (conjunto de unidades rayadas duplicadas). Este tipo de sistema RAID es una buena opción para los usuarios domésticos que usarán el sistema RAID con un solo sistema informático.
  • El RAID basado en hardware es la opción para ambas configuraciones complejas de RAID, como la utilizada en RAID 3 o RAID 5 que incorporan los bits de paridad que se generan y comparan en tiempo real a medida que los datos se envían hacia y desde la matriz RAID. El RAID basado en hardware también es una buena opción para los sistemas RAID 0 y RAID 1 más básicos cuando desea que el gabinete RAID sea independiente del equipo host, lo que le permite mover el sistema entre varios equipos.